DESCRIPTION:The Kent Downtown Partnership (KDP) has announced the launch of its “Illuminate Downtown” campaign\, aimed at revitalizing the historic downtown area with new\, energy-efficient lighting to improve aesthetics and safety. \n\n\n\nRecognizing the need for significant improvements to the aged lighting infrastructure in Historic Downtown Kent\, the KDP is seizing additional funding opportunities to transform the area into a beautifully lit and welcoming environment. \n“Our goal is to install new\, energy-efficient lighting to enhance both aesthetics and safety downtown\,” KDP organizers said. “However\, we need community help to make this vision a reality. We invite you to consider supporting us in this endeavor by increasing your B&O contribution this year\, sponsoring the project\, or making an individual contribution. Most importantly\, join us in this endeavor to make an impact in our community.” \n\nKDP is hoping to raise $100\,000 with this campaign\, which will run through Dec. 31\, 2024. Donations are tax deductible. If KDP doesn’t reach its goal of $100K\, the project WILL move forward in phases commensurate with funding received. \nFor more information\, please contact Gaila Haas at 253-813-6976 or email ghaas@kentdowntown.org. \nLaunch Party will be Thursday\, Aug. 1\nTo kick off the project\, KDP is hosting a Launch Party at Thai Chili (map below) from 5–6:30 p.m. on Thursday\, Aug. 1\, 2024\, inviting the community to learn more and show support.
